Output 3d943f811491433ee1cbc6182b826606153a0f33316809befccbcb8577d526a4:29

value
668919
script pubkey
OP_0 OP_PUSHBYTES_20 45f7de81c9e33cb1ca305f8ba74a1d07b22a9790
address
bc1qghmaaqwfuv7trj3st796wjsaq7ez49uss3lact
transaction
3d943f811491433ee1cbc6182b826606153a0f33316809befccbcb8577d526a4
spent
true